Kevin McIlvoy: The Editor Comes Clean At Last, Part II (July 1998)

$5.00

Adopting the conceit of an editor who has—to his subsequent chagrin—rejected all of Katherine Anne Porter’s writing, Kevin McIlvoy examines a range of Porter’s work for what it can teach writers and editors alike.  Through close readings of “María Concep–ción,” “Flowering Judas,” “The Leaning Tower,” “Noon Wine,” and Pale Horse, Pale Rider, McIlvoy traces the development of Porter’s comedic voice, and of her honest, objective stance, that, even as it generates pessimism, also generates empathy.
